Dogs can’t talk to us directly. To communicate with us, they use a different set of methods. Some of them are non-verbal, while others are verbal. Staring at their owner is one such non-verbal method that dogs use to communicate. 

Why does my dog stare at me all the time? Your dog stares at you for three main things. He’s trying to tell you something, and he’s reading you and trying to understand you, or he loves you so much and is looking for some attention from you.

  • He loves you so much

When the dog is extremely bored and close with his owner, he will love you so much that he actually can’t take his eyes away from you. He will stare at you while following your every move, creeping you out.

But the good news is that he’s cautious and protective of you and keeps an eye on you to keep you safe from possible harm. 

  • He’s looking for your attention

Are you sure you are giving your pet enough time and affection? If not, he will try to grab your attention by staring at you.

So it is better to try a little harder to spend quality time with your puppy and bond with him daily. He loves you so much, and your attention and pets mean everything to him. So spare a few minutes every day to send with your pet.

  • They are asking for something

If your pet is intently looking at you, it could also mean that he’s asking for something. Maybe your puppy is hungry or thirsty, and the bowels are empty. Or he might want to run out for a quick second to release his bladder.

You will easily read this when you grow closer to the dog. And if you have a new pup, reading and understanding his body language enough to recongnize what he’s trying to say might be a little tricky.

Although dogs stare at their owners to communicate, not every dog is the same. If you see a stray dog staring at you from the other side of the road, it doesn’t mean he’s asking you to pet and give him attention. 

If a stray dog is looking at you, the best thing you can do is turn and walk away from the scene as fast as you can. Because, sometimes, a stare means just a warning that dogs release before they jump on you and attack.
